Pondsville, Massachusetts

36 topographic sheets cover this place, the earliest surveyed in 1888 and the latest in 1994. It stands in Barnstable Town City. It lies in ZIP code area 02648. The Survey maps it on the Sandwich quadrangle.

Fires nearby

131 since 2003

The federal wildfire occurrence database lists 131 fires within 5 miles of Pondsville between 2003 and 2020, burning about 85 acres in total. 6 started naturally. 7 were recorded as arson. Distance is straight-line from the map coordinates, so a fire counted here may appear on a neighbouring settlement's page as well.

Specimens collected nearby

12 of 2,564 shown

Museums hold 2,564 specimens collected within 10 miles of Pondsville between 1816 and 1975: 1,679 Animalia, 633 Plantae, 148 Fungi, 94 Chromista, 7 Protozoa, 2 Unrecorded, 1 Bacteria. 12 distinct Species records are shown. Collected by A. B. Seymour, A. R. Hodgdon, A. R. Hodgdon; E. J. Hehre and others. Each is a physical object with a catalogue number, and each entry opens the museum's record. This is what was collected and kept, not a survey of what lives here - nothing can be concluded from a species being absent.

Mines and quarries nearby

7 within 5 miles

The federal mineral resources record lists 7 workings within 5 miles of Pondsville: 5 past producers, 2 producers. 2 still produce. What was taken out: Sand and Gravel, Construction.
